用于位置的MS图形API始终返回null等“ Building”,“ Floor”之类的属性

问题描述

嗨,我正在使用以下API来获取资源邮箱详细信息。

 var place = await graphClient.Places["[email protected]"]
.Request()
.GetAsync();

但是建筑物,楼层等属性始终为空。即使它在交换服务器中也有价值。这些值可以使用PowerShell命令获得。

 Get-Place -Identity "[email protected]"

enter image description here

感谢您的帮助。

解决方法

不确定这是我们先前工作的重复问题。我仍然会继续回答。

(1)可以使用设置场所Exchange PowerShell cmdlet设置Exchange在线邮箱的值并更新其元数据信息。这是相关的documentation link

(2)然后,使用Graph API SDK或MS Graph Explorer进行API调用,它将返回值。